Hi, I forgot to tell, that I did not find out when the serial got messed up.
I was able to reduce the serial in the unsigned file. I forced signing, this repaired the signed zone on the (hidden) master. I deleted the zone file on all slaves and restarted bind. All nodes loaded the correct zone file after this. Volker > Am 16.07.2014 um 19:18 schrieb Rick van Rein <r...@openfortress.nl>: > > Hello, > >> no I wasn't aware of this.
